Solve Jane Street's Stack Machine Challenge

This specific coding challenge, frequently used in technical interviews, presents a simulated stack-based calculator. Candidates are typically provided with a simplified instruction set and a sequence of operations to execute on this virtual machine. These operations often include pushing numerical values onto the stack, performing arithmetic calculations using stack elements, and conditional logic based on the stack’s state. A sample instruction set might include operations like “PUSH,” “POP,” “ADD,” “SUB,” “MULT,” “DIV,” and “DUP.” An example task could be to evaluate the result of a given sequence such as “PUSH 5, PUSH 3, ADD, PUSH 2, MULT.”

The exercise serves as an effective assessment of a candidate’s understanding of fundamental computer science concepts. It tests proficiency in stack manipulation, algorithm execution, and logical reasoning. Its popularity stems from the ability to quickly evaluate a candidate’s problem-solving skills and aptitude for abstract thinking within a constrained environment. Furthermore, the abstract nature of a stack machine makes it applicable across a range of programming paradigms and languages, making it a versatile assessment tool.

Best Iso-Lateral Row Machines of 2024: Top Picks

This type of exercise equipment facilitates independent arm movements during rowing exercises. This design allows for unilateral training, addressing strength imbalances between sides and promoting balanced muscle development. Each arm works independently, pulling its own weight stack or resistance mechanism. This contrasts with traditional rowing machines where both arms move simultaneously.

Unilateral training offers several advantages. It helps identify and correct muscular asymmetries, often overlooked in bilateral exercises. This focused approach can lead to improved core stability as the body works to maintain balance during single-arm movements. It also contributes to greater overall strength gains by ensuring each side of the body works to its full potential. This equipment has become increasingly popular in strength training and rehabilitation settings due to its targeted nature and potential for injury prevention.

8+ ATM Machine RTOs & Recovery Objectives

Automated teller machines (ATMs) provide essential financial services, and any disruption to their availability can significantly impact customers and financial institutions. Therefore, establishing a maximum acceptable period of downtime, typically expressed as a Recovery Time Objective (RTO), is crucial. For example, a bank might set an RTO of two hours for its ATMs, meaning the goal is to restore service within two hours of an outage. This objective influences decisions about backup systems, redundancy, and disaster recovery procedures.

Defining and adhering to an RTO minimizes customer inconvenience, reduces potential financial losses from lost transactions, and helps maintain the reputation of the financial institution. Historically, as ATMs became more integrated into daily life, the need for robust recovery strategies became increasingly apparent. Downtime can stem from hardware malfunctions, software glitches, network outages, or even power failures. A well-defined RTO ensures a swift and organized response to these incidents, limiting their impact.

Can a Rube Goldberg Machine Be Impossible to Build?

A Rube Goldberg machine, by its very nature, involves creating a complex chain reaction to achieve a simple task. The question of its impossibility hinges on interpreting “impossible” in different contexts. Physically constructing an excessively intricate apparatus may face practical limitations regarding space, resources, and the precise timing required for each step to function flawlessly. Theoretically, however, designing increasingly elaborate contraptions is limited only by creativity and the laws of physics. A simple example is a domino chain reaction; extending this concept with additional steps and mechanisms illustrates the core principle.

The value of these devices lies not in practicality but in fostering creative problem-solving and demonstrating physical principles in an engaging way. Originating in the early 20th century through the cartoons of engineer and cartoonist Rube Goldberg, these whimsical inventions became a cultural touchstone, appearing in everything from films and television to competitions and educational projects. Their continued popularity highlights an enduring fascination with ingenuity and the playful exploration of cause and effect.

Cuisinart EM-200: Espresso Pressure vs. Regular Machines?

Espresso machines require a specific pressure level, typically around 9 bars, to extract coffee properly. A lower pressure may result in weak, under-extracted espresso, while excessive pressure can lead to a bitter, over-extracted brew. The Cuisinart EM-200, like other espresso machines, aims to achieve this ideal pressure range for optimal espresso extraction. Comparisons with less precise methods like drip coffee makers or French presses highlight the importance of this targeted pressure for espresso’s distinct characteristics. Standard drip coffee makers, for instance, do not operate under pressure, yielding a substantially different brewing dynamic and final product.

Achieving the correct pressure is crucial for producing the rich crema, balanced flavor, and concentrated character expected from espresso. The ability of a machine to consistently deliver this pressure influences the quality and consistency of the espresso it produces. Historically, achieving and maintaining stable pressure in home espresso machines has been a challenge. Advancements in pump technology and thermoblock heating systems have made it more attainable in affordable models, improving the accessibility of quality espresso. Understanding this pressure requirement clarifies the significance of design features and technical specifications when evaluating espresso machines.

9+ Best Inner & Outer Thigh Machines for Sculpted Legs

Equipment designed for lower body workouts often targets specific muscle groups within the thighs. Machines focusing on these areas typically involve adjustable resistance and controlled movements, such as adduction (moving the leg toward the midline of the body) and abduction (moving the leg away from the midline). Examples include seated hip adduction/abduction machines, some cable systems with ankle straps, and certain types of resistance bands.

Strengthening these muscles contributes to improved hip stability, balance, and overall lower body strength. This can benefit athletic performance in activities like running and jumping, as well as everyday movements like walking and climbing stairs. Historically, the focus on targeted exercise for these muscle groups emerged alongside advancements in exercise physiology and biomechanics, leading to the development of specialized fitness equipment.
